Interview with Brush, Benjamin

Macdonald, John. Interview with Brush, Benjamin, 1764-1847; (1846-11-19). Experiencing the Neutral Ground of the American Revolution: The McDonald Interviews, WCHS item 1732. Transcription courtesy of the Westchester County Historical Society (No copyright - United States). Passage 3 of 4 255 words

He was overtaken and the plume cut from his cap by the British dragoons. (Heard and Peyton and eight or twelve men.) - Heard said to Peyton: "It's a pity to see poor Keese killed. Let's separate and let 'em pass." They separated - that is, wheeled right to left) Keese passed, and they then attacked and killed the two pursuers. Peyton was afterwards killed in a duel with Lieut. When Hopkins attacked Emmerick at Young's House, Heard and Peyton were among the foremost in the pursuit. - Sergeant Carr, however, was ahead of all the pursuers, and wanted to take Emmerick's horse which was a very fine one. Carr said he could have killed the horse easily, but wished to take him unhurt. Heard called out to him: "Push on, Carr! - Push on!" The Yagers (infan- -try) were afraid of firing upon Heard's party till their retreat, lest they should hurt Emmerick and his men; but when they turned to retreat they were fired at by a great number, but rode through it.
